Jay Clayton Sworn in as U.S. National Intelligence Director
Jay Clayton was sworn in as the U.S. National Intelligence Director, having previously served as the chairman of the U.S.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C). The ceremony was conducted by White House Special Assistant Margo Martin on Tuesday. Clayton was confirmed by the Senate with a vote of 51 to 47, making him the highest-ranking official in the U.S. intelligence community. He will take over from Tulsi Gabbard and will be responsible for coordinating among the country's intelligence agencies. Clayton is known for the lawsuit against Ripple in the cryptocurrency sector. The SEC filed a lawsuit against Ripple Labs and its executives on December 22, 2020, which coincided with Clayton's last day in office as SEC chairman. The case continued during Gary Gensler's tenure after Clayton's departure. Ripple achieved significant victories in court, leading to changes in the SEC's approach to cryptocurrency assets. After leaving the SEC, Clayton altered his perspective on the digital asset sector and joined the advisory board of One River Asset Management. He also served on the advisory board of the cryptocurrency infrastructure company Fireblocks. Clayton made positive statements regarding blockchain technology and anticipated the emergence of comprehensive cryptocurrency legislation in the U.S.
